When you > say the last two children were Marina's, which two are you speaking of, > Mary (Polly) Etheridge, Sarah (Sally) Etheridge, or the possible child, > David Etheridge, Jr.? > Rita > > > > ----- Original Message ----- > From: "Brenda Sensenig" <sensenib@insightbb.com> > To: <TNSTEWAR-L@rootsweb.com> > Sent: Thursday, September 16, 2004 7:41 PM > Subject: RE: [TNSTEWAR] Lancaster; & Skinner & Etheridge & Dennis & Phillips > & Joice > > > > Chuck, > > I have a copy of the will of Nathan Skinner. I have also been to his grave > > located in the Mt Zion Cemetery in Stewart County. According to his stone, > > he was born Jan 29, 1779 and died Oct 26, 1846. > > He was married three times. First, Marcy unknown. They were divorced in > 1827 > > in Stewart County. > > Second, Marina Unknown. The last two children are hers. She was born Oct > 3, > > 1805 and died Dec 19, 1845 and is buried next to him. His last wife, > > Elizabeth Unknown Bruton out lived him. > > In his will, he mentions his daughter, Penina, wife of John Fletcher! > > Brenda > > > > -----Original Message----- > > From: Chuck Phillips [mailto:75271.2472@compuserve.com] > > Sent: Thursday, September 16, 2004 11:43 AM > > To: TNSTEWAR-L@rootsweb.com > > Subject: [TNSTEWAR] Lancaster; & Skinner & Etheridge & Dennis & Phillips & > > Joice > > > > Hi, y'all, > > > > For years, I have watched all you cousins relate your many ties with > > all the long-time names in Stewart Co.
